Let's talk about current industry trends related to this course. What are some key developments? GUEST: There's growing emphasis on incorporating artificial intelligence and machine learning in risk evaluation. These technologies can help improve accuracy and efficiency in risk identification and assessment. HOST: That's fascinating! With these advancements, what challenges do you think learners and teachers might face? GUEST: One challenge is keeping up-to-date with cutting-edge techniques. Continuous learning is essential for both instructors and students to stay relevant in the field. HOST: Absolutely. Looking forward, where do you see the future of risk evaluation in engineering? GUEST: I anticipate increased automation in risk assessment and a stronger focus on human factors, ensuring that systems are not only reliable but also user-friendly and safe.
